About the Role
International Maritime Industries seeks a QC Document Controller in Riyadh to manage project documentation and records for quality management. The role involves creating and maintaining document systems, ensuring compliance with technical requirements, and supporting field inspection personnel.
Key Skills for This Role
Responsibilities
- Create and maintain project documents in existing file management systems.
- Generate and review certification document packages for quality assurance reviews.
- Work closely with contractors, sub contractors, quality assurance, and quality control team members to ensure QA and project requirements for document management are being met.
- Development of meeting minutes and administrative tasks as necessary to support the construction team.
- Interpret contract specifications and applicable standards for project document management.
- Maintain confidentiality regarding sensitive documents and establish/maintain record retention timelines.
- Handle records across various departments, keep other personnel updated on new document version and how to obtain access.
- Collect and register all technical documents such as drawings and blueprints in the company's system.
- Support field inspection personnel in materials documentation processes.
- Scan and upload documents according to Company procedure.
- Ensure compliance with all applicable information security policies & procedures.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ree / higher diploma
- No experience required
